Donald Trump has officially begun his second term as President of the United States, taking the oath of office as the 47th president in the 60th presidential inauguration. During the ceremony, Trump pledged to “restore America’s promise,” marking a significant moment in his return to the White House.
Trump’s inauguration was attended by key figures, including outgoing President Joe Biden, who welcomed Trump and his wife Melania to the White House for a tea and coffee reception. The event was also attended by other prominent guests, such as Elon Musk and Secretary of State-designate Marco Rubio.
As Trump begins his second term, he has promised to take swift action on various issues, including immigration, border security, energy, and governance. He is expected to sign up to 200 executive orders on his first day in office, aiming to implement his policy agenda without needing congressional approval.
Donald Trump’s second inauguration address was delivered on January 20, 2025. Here’s the summary of his full speech:
Trump began by thanking the audience and acknowledging the presence of former presidents, justices of the Supreme Court, and other dignitaries. He declared that the “golden age of America begins right now” and promised that the country will flourish and be respected again worldwide.
Trump emphasized his commitment to putting America first, reclaiming sovereignty, restoring safety, and rebalancing the scales of justice. He also vowed to create a nation that is proud, prosperous, and free.
The president announced several executive orders, including declaring a national emergency at the southern border, stopping all government censorship, and restoring free speech to America. He also promised to end the practice of catch and release, send troops to the southern border, and designate cartels as foreign terrorist organizations.
Trump’s speech also touched on economic issues, including reducing inflation, increasing energy production, and promoting American manufacturing. He pledged to restore America’s promise and rebuild the nation, emphasizing the importance of unity and patriotism.
Throughout the speech, Trump emphasized his commitment to making America great again, restoring its reputation, and ensuring its prosperity. He concluded by thanking the audience and saying, “God bless America.”
